Madrid, 2025.05.29.- MEASNET (International Network of Wind Energy Measurement Institutes) has just released the 20ac01 Anemometer Calibration Proficiency Test (PT) final report. It presents the outcome of the intercomparison conducted in this competence area by 14 international technical laboratories from Australia, Brazil, China, Denmark, Germany, Greece, Spain and the USA, among other countries.
These test labs have proven their competence through a rigorous, independent evaluation which more than 85% of the participants have passed. MEASNET members have achieved particularly outstanding results, demonstrating a lower level of spread.
This is the fifth public report issued by MEASNET on proficiency testing performed under the rules of IECRE (IEC System for Certification to Standards Relating to Equipment for Use in Renewable Energy Applications), and the last in the series for the most recent batch of PTs. They compile relevant details about the work of technical laboratories in the wind energy sector involved in these intercomparisons. Releasing these documents to the public aligns with MEASNET’s policy of transparency.
“The report on the Anemometer Calibration PT provides a true and up-to-date picture of the high level of accuracy of anemometer calibration measurements by participating laboratories,” says Alejandro Martínez, MEASNET Vice Chairman and Technical Advisor for PTs, as well as IECRE Lead Assessor.
“Additionally, it’s important to note that participating MEASNET members achieved better results by demonstrating lower spread,” he added. “This harmonization of results is the fruit of the work performed by the MEASNET Expert Group in this area of competence over the years.”
The report on 20ac01 Anemometer Calibration Proficiency Test has been coordinated by Søren Frølund Østbirk, the test’s conductor and ingenieer in Svend Ole Hansen ApS.
It is now available for its free download from the MEASNET website, along with the ones focused on Power Performance, Acoustic Noise, Loads and Electrical Characteristics: www.measnet.com/finished-pts
MEASNET is the official IECRE provider for Proficiency Tests in the wind industry worldwide, assessing qualification according to harmonised and aligned criteria. More than 90 laboratories have been involved in these technical evaluations since their inception, in 2020. Proficiency testing proves competence through inter-laboratory testing, and fosters mutual trust which enables international acceptance.
About MEASNET
MEASNET, International Network of Wind Energy Measurement Institutes, is a non-profit organisation for accredited technical service providers engaged in the field of wind energy. Founded in 1997, its goal is to ensure high quality measurements, uniform interpretation of standards and recommendations, as well as interchangeability of results.
MEASNET currently counts 29 members, which are technical laboratories from Australia, China, Denmark, Germany, Greece, Spain, The Netherlands, The United Kingdom, and The United States.
Since 2015, MEASNET holds an agreement with IECRE to offer and perform Proficiency Tests under the rules of IECRE as a privileged partner. Furthermore, in 2019, MEASNET signed an A-Liaison with the IEC TC 88 group to promote technology transfer and speed up the process of development and updating of technical guidelines.
